Accountancy newspapers and accountant newsletters are great sources of current information that you should make an integral part of your daily routine. Keeping up with all the changes going on in your industry is vital to your remaining competitive. Accountancy newspapers typically will keep you informed of pending legislation that could affect you, major trends that reporters and researchers have discovered and changes among executive positions at your competitors.
Make reading accounting newsletters a part of your corporate culture so that all your employees are plugged in and ready to share what they learn each week. You also might consider writing for newspapers on accounting that will give you and your firm more industry exposure, or sending your clients regular accounting newsletters with information they can use. Bring accounting newsletters into your company through a variety of avenues.
1. Subscribe to important accountancy newsletters
2. Insist that employees read CPA firm newsletters
3. Send newsletters for accountants to your clients

Find accountant newsletters to stay well-informed
Take time to sift through the vast number of accountancy newsletters that come across your desk to find the ones that speak to your place in the industry and will provide you with the most pertinent information. While you may subscribe to a few hard copies of accounting news, others you can quickly peruse online. Ask your staff to read different accounting newsletters and pass on important information they learn.

Get your employees to read accounting newspapers and newsletters
An easy way to encourage employees to take the initiative to read industry reports and news is to open each staff meeting for employees to share what they've learned in their regular reading. You also could request regular reports if you have managers and other tracking industry changes through various news sources.

Keep your name in front of clients with accounting firms newsletters
Accounting newspapers provide a great venue to market your services, whether you send out a quick email newsletter once a month, weekly tax tips for clients, or produce major white papers and articles that your clients will appreciate. You can hire a freelance writer to compose your newsletters and send them by mail or through emails, or request regular written contributions from your employees. You can find ready-made templates for your company newsletters online too.
